Iphone not syncing address to nav

I just upgraded my iphone to 3gs and paired it with the X6 ( after deleting old pairing entry) and everything works fine from the phone standpoint.
However there is something strange going on and I can't figure out how to rectify it. After pairing, all my contact name and phone numbers show up under the communication address book.

When I go to the navigation section and select "new destination" and "from address book" all that shows is one entry that I manually entered a couple months ago via idrive. None of the contacts that are in the communication section show up.

So what am I missing ?

I think they are two seperate databases. I also have an iPhone 3GS and its contents are loaded into the communication address book. The navigation address book contains manual entries and those sent from mapping engines like Google Maps (which is pretty cool). From what I can tell, you can't select a phone address book entry and map it through navigation. I will keep playing, maybe we are missing something.
